Lakeside Software Appoints Daniel Salinas as COO to Drive AI-Powered Growth in Digital Employee Experience

Lakeside Software has appointed Daniel Salinas as Chief Operating Officer, marking his return to the company where he previously served as Vice President of Business Development. Salinas brings over 25 years of enterprise IT leadership experience, including 18 years at IBM in technical, sales, and management roles, and will oversee global Sales, Customer Success, Customer Support, and Business Development functions.

The appointment comes as organizations face increasing pressure to optimize digital employee experience in hybrid work environments. Salinas emphasized that Lakeside is evolving to meet these challenges by shifting IT from reactive support functions toward site reliability engineering principles, focusing on predictability, automation, and resilience. This transformation enables IT teams to proactively address issues rather than react to tickets, delivering the seamless digital experiences employees expect.

Salinas highlighted Lakeside's practical impact through a case study involving a major bank that planned to refresh 7,000 laptops. By analyzing real-world usage data from Lakeside's endpoint sensors, the organization discovered only 600 devices actually required replacement, resulting in approximately $9 million in savings that could be redirected to other projects.

The company's AI and automation capabilities are driving significant productivity gains across enterprises. One organization used Lakeside's technology to prevent more than 205,000 help desk tickets monthly through continuous monitoring, anomaly detection, and automated fixes. This "invisible IT" approach reduces tech friction for end users while delivering measurable outcomes that justify IT investments.

Salinas' leadership philosophy, shaped by his extensive experience and educational background including a Bachelor of Engineering from the University of Michigan and an MBA from the Ross School of Business, focuses on building cross-functional alignment and resilience. He compares leadership challenges to hurdling in track and field, emphasizing the need to coach teams over obstacles rather than avoiding them.

As COO, Salinas aims to scale Lakeside's operations while maintaining customer focus, ensuring the company can grow efficiently without losing sight of customer needs.
